Where Higgins veers west and becomes 39th Street, you'll find a neighborhood perched above the Missoula valley. The area known as Farviews is aptly named for its fantastic vantage point. Streets curve around the rolling terrain--the perfect location for the highlands Golf Course. Just east of the Farviews neighborhood, a narrow and lush canyon cuts along the north side of Mount Sentinel--this is known as Pattee Canyon. Named for settler David Pattee, the canyon is one of the most popular recreation areas in town. You would never know you are within 10 minutes of the UM campus with homes hidden by thick pine trees near babbling Pattee Creek.

The public schools that serve the Pattee Canyon/Farviews area are the Lewis and Clark grade school, the Washington Middle School and Sentinel High School.
